    The development of Web technology has brought a new insight into China´s English language teaching and learning. This paper is a one-and-a-half-year experiment of testing the effectiveness of two teaching methods based on the computer and traditional classrooms in Wuhan University of Technology. Two classes of students from both the higher level (Level A) and the average level (Level B) of grade 2006 were taught by the Online Learning Plus model and the other two classes from the two levels were taught by the Online Learning Alone model. The goal was to optimize students´ language learning and to find a new direction of teaching innovation. The final results indicated that it was highly likely that there existed real differences in student learning as a function of teaching methods. The Online Learning Plus model was proved to be superior to the Online Alone model for both the higher-level students and the average-level students.
